Digital Bharat Nidhi and Andhra Pradesh partner for BharatNet rollout

New agreement unlocks ₹2,432 crore to upgrade rural telecom infrastructure and provide 500,000 fiber connections

New Delhi :Digital Bharat Nidhi and the Government of Andhra Pradesh signed a Memorandum of Cooperation (MoC) on Sunday to fast-track the Amended BharatNet Programme (ABP), aimed at bringing high-speed broadband to every village in the state.

The agreement was formalized on Feb.  22 at the Chief Minister’s Camp Office in the presence of Union Minister for Communications Jyotiraditya M. Scindia,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u, and Minister of State for Communications Dr. Pemmasani Chandra Sekhar.

The Government of India has approved ₹2,432 crore in financial support for the initiative in Andhra Pradesh. This funding is expected to facilitate over 500,000 rural home fiber connections, boosting digital governance, telemedicine, and online education in remote areas.

“Amended BharatNet is a $16.9 billion publicly funded program… which will take OFC fiber and broadband to every single village of this country,” Minister Scindia said. He described the effort as the “democratization of technology” for every citizen.

Chief Minister Naidu called the memorandum a milestone for the state’s digital transformation, noting that seamless connectivity would empower rural communities and enhance healthcare and education delivery.The project will be executed through a new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V), Andhra Pradesh BharatNet Infrastructure Limited (APBIL). The scope of the program covers 13,426 Gram Panchayats, including:
  • The upgradation of 1,692 Phase I Gram Panchayats from linear to ring topology to improve network resilience.
  • The coverage of 11,254 Phase II Gram Panchayats.
  • The inclusion of 480 newly created Gram Panchayats.
  • On-demand connectivity for 3,942 additional villages to strengthen last-mile access.
Under the agreement, the state government will provide essential support for implementation, including coordination for Right of Way (RoW) and infrastructure access. Dr. Pemmasani Chandra Sekhar noted that the partnership provides a sustainable framework for swift implementation, ensuring that rural citizens gain access to affordable and dependable digital services.
